DB2 Load Utility top parameters example JCL

The Load utility in DB2 is a series of steps. When you need Load Utility is the first step you always need to know. The answer is if you want to import data into DB2 tables in bulk, then you need to use Load utility. The series of steps also called different phases of DB2 Load utility execution.

The load utility is a little bit like the supercharged, speed version of the import utility.

There are sample JCLs those are frequently used in Load and Unload of data from to and pro to DB2. In simple terms, LOAD means importing data, and UNLOAD means exporting the data. This is one of the interview question.

It supports the full range of capabilities of the import command, but has many more options to control the speed and efficiency of a given load process.

But with added speed comes a cost. To provide this breakneck capability to load data, the load utility sacrifices several important checks and defers several others.

The de-merits of LOAD utility

The load utility only minimally logs its actions and completely ignores table triggers. It defers the changes to indexes and the checks for referential integrity, potentially masking problems until late in the load process.

Load utility in DB2 come with some key phrases or parameters. These are good for your interviews and to have command over these also good.

data buffer

Enables multiple 4KB buffers to be allocated for dealing with data transfer

sort buffer sortheap

Enables a load-specific sort buffer to be allocated, rather than the default

cpu_parallelism

Controls the number of threads allocated for data preparation, such as reading, parsing, and formatting

disk_parallelism

Controls the number of threads allocated to write out loaded data to the DB2 containers

fetch_parallelism

Controls the capability to spawn multiple threads for fetching source data from a cursor defined from another database

indexing mode

Enables the relevant index updates on target tables to be deferred

sourceuserexit

Enables a program to be called to provide the source data
